Interpreting Wang Yue's Words
Daizong: Mount Tai, also known as Daishan, is honored as Daizong because it ranks first among the five mountains.
Qilu: The ancient name of the two countries refers to Shandong.
Nature: refers to heaven and earth and nature.
Zhong: Assemble.
Yin and Yang: Yin refers to the north of the mountain and Yang refers to the south of the mountain.
Cut: points.
Stratospheric clouds: clouds and gases are layered and changeable.

Appreciation of Wang Yue's Poems
Looking at the Moon is the earliest extant poem of Du Fu. The poet reached the foot of Mount Tai, but did not climb it, so he named it "Wangyue". This poem depicts the majestic atmosphere of Mount Tai and expresses the poet's desire to reach the summit. Show an enterprising and positive attitude towards life, which is very philosophical. This poem is magnificent, comprehensive in brushwork and sonorous in words, which fully shows the outstanding creative talent of young Du Fu.
